Chiller Operation and Maintenance

Pressure and Temperature Log

A log of temperatures and pressures should be taken

regularly . Periodically conduct a visual inspection of the

chiller to identify problems before they reach the point of

failure . As with any mechanical system, it is necessary to

conduct a series of checks to confirm correct operation
of the chiller .

Daily

• A daily operational log should be kept .

• Perform visual inspection .

• Record entering and leaving chiller water and

condenser water temperatures and pressures .

• Properly document all data taken .

• Note any problems that may exist and

immediately plan for further investigation . If

repair is necessary, schedule for the earliest

possible date .

Weekly

• Review daily log from previous week .

• Perform visual inspection .

• Properly document all data taken .

• Note any problems that may exist and immediately

plan for further investigation . If repair is necessary,

schedule for the earliest possible date .

Quarterly

• Check Master Control Panel operating parameters

and set points .

• Check temperature drop/rise on each individual

heat exchanger . *

• Check compressor oil level .

• Check compressor oil color .

• Check water flow rates and pressure drops across

evaporator and condenser heat exchangers .

• Properly document all data taken .

• Check all electrical connections for tightness .

* The temperature drop/rise on a fully loaded (both

compressors) heat exchanger is generally 10°F . If only one

compressor is running, the temperature drop/rise will be

approximately 5°F . Some projects are designed to have a

higher or lower temperature drop on either the evaporator

or the condenser depending on application . Consult the

bank performance sheet for specific project requirements for

these values . If the temperature drop/rise is greater than the

design, the heat exchanger may need to be back flushed or

the strainer may need to be cleaned .

Annual

• Back flush all heat exchangers. If fouling is suspected

use only ClimaCool recommended de-scalers (see page

43 – Chemical Clean In Place Washing) .

• Remove and clean all waterside strainers .

• Manually operate all waterside isolation valves,

if provided, on each module .

• Check all electrical connections for tightness .

• Perform leak check on all refrigerant circuits .

• Check all header piping couplings for tightness .

• Check oil level and color on each compressor .

• Check and test all refrigerant safeties for

proper operation .

• Check all peripheral systems for proper operation .

• Check and test CoolLogic Control System .

• Verify set points, sensors and general control

configuration.

• Properly document all data taken .
